After years of responding to Midlothian proper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Midlothian property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Storm damage often shows up first as a small ceiling stain in Midlothian properties, but by the time it's visible, water has usually already reached the insulation and framing underneath.
A failed sump pump during a heavy rain event is one of the fastest ways a Midlothian basement goes from dry to flooded — often within a single storm, with little warning.
A slowly failing water heater in a Midlothian home can leak for weeks before it's discovered, often causing more structural damage than a sudden pipe burst would.
Poor drainage patterns are a frequent contributor to recurring water issues in Midlothian basements, especially in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ping and settled soil.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Midlothian property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Plenty of Midlothian hom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Midlothian hom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
There's also the insurance side to consider. Without professional documentation — moisture readings, photos, a written scope of work — it can be much harder to support a claim if secondary damage shows up later. Our Midlothian technicians build that documentation as part of every job, protecting you if issues surface down the road.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
Every water loss is different, but these general safety steps apply to most Midlothian calls we receive.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
If water is anywhere near electrical panels or outlets in your Midlothian property, stay away and avoid that area entirely.
Lifting rugs, moving boxes, and relocating valuables can reduce secondary damage while you wait for our team.
A quick photo record of standing water and affected belongings makes the insurance process smoother down the line.
If weather allows, opening windows or doors can help slow humidity buildup until our Midlothian team arrives with drying equipment.
Delaying the call is the most common mistake we see. Standing water only gets more expensive to fix the longer it sits.
